COLUMBIA, S.C. - (April 8, 2011) Columbia, S.C. will welcome about 100 special forces men and families as Celebrate Freedom Foundation celebrates American's Vietnam era veterans with the 13th Annual Celebrate Freedom Festival and Army Special Forces Association Regional Convention on Friday, April 15, and Saturday, April 16, 2011. The 13th Annual Celebrate Freedom Festival will be held on Saturday at Finlay Park in downtown Columbia from 9: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.

In addition, a school education day will be held on Friday, as well as a Heroes of Freedom dinner at the Medallion Center to honor the Montagnard People, "The Forgotten Army." The festival on Saturday will feature living history displays, historic home tours and a free concert featuring J. Edwards Band, The Return, and MoTown recording artist Martha Reeves and the Vandellas,.

The 2nd Annual Vietnam Homecoming is themed "The Helicopter War." Vietnam helicopters such as the Huey, Cobra, Loach and OH-58 will be on display, along with military vehicles, living history, field encampments and reenactments. In years past, the Heroes of Freedom honored the Doolittle Raiders, Tuskegee Airmen, Navajo Code Talkers, "Triple Nickel" 555th Parachute Infantry, and Enduring Freedom Veterans.

About the Celebrate Freedom Foundation
The Celebrate Freedom Foundation is a non-profit educational and historical 501 (c)3 corporation dedicated to educating the public and children about the sacrifices made in defense of freedom and democracy, promoting lasting patriotism in all Americans and honoring past, present and future military.
